( ) Gideon is a wolf Wyr investigator who meets Alice after she found her friend and fellow chameleon shifter murdered. He's been in the Army for a 100 years and isn't sure how comfortable he is living in the city. He comes across as the big, bad, lonely alpha. Whereas Alice is a shy, introvert and one of the rare Chameleon Wyr. Alice had just discovered her friend's body and hides when she hears Gideon come on the scene. At first Alice thought he might be the murderer so she hides and then runs from him, but once that's cleared up she realized he's her mate. Gideon took a look at Alice and found his 'true north' not realizing she was his mate but knowing he'd found home. This is a quick novella but it's packed full of good stuff if you want a quick romance. I'm glad their relationship was the focus and the murder was more background as it was pretty obvious who the killer had to be. Rated: 3 Stars A short e-book set in Harrison's Elder Races series. I really adored this short story. Alice Clark is a rare species of shifters. Her kind has been hunted to the point of near extinction, so when a serial killer starts targeting her small community of shifters she's assigned a personal body guard, wolf shifter Gideon Riehl. This was a really fast paced short story, I figured out who the serial killer was fairly early in the story but the ride was still really fun. Gideon and Alice were both great characters, so watching them get to know one another was the main attraction to the book. I would highly recommend this to anyone looking for a quick paranormal romance read. aucune critique | ajouter une critique

HTML: Meeting your soulmate? Great. Preventing your possible murder? Even better. A Novella of the Elder Races Alice Clark, a Wyr and schoolteacher, has had two friends murdered in as many days, and she's just found the body of a third. She arrives at the scene only minutes before Gideon Riehl, a wolf Wyr and current detective in the Wyr Division of Violent Crimeâ??and, as Alice oh-so-inconveniently recognizes at first sight, her mate. But the sudden connection Riehl and Alice feel is complicated when the murders are linked to a serial killer who last struck seven years ago, killing seven people in seven days. They have just one night before the killer strikes again. And every sign points to Alice as the next victim.
